/**
* Biometric factors.
*/
export var BioFactor;
(function (BioFactor) {
BioFactor[BioFactor["Multiple"] = 1] = "Multiple";
BioFactor[BioFactor["FacialFeatures"] = 2] = "FacialFeatures";
BioFactor[BioFactor["Voice"] = 4] = "Voice";
BioFactor[BioFactor["Fingerprint"] = 8] = "Fingerprint";
BioFactor[BioFactor["Iris"] = 16] = "Iris";
BioFactor[BioFactor["Retina"] = 32] = "Retina";
BioFactor[BioFactor["HandGeometry"] = 64] = "HandGeometry";
BioFactor[BioFactor["SignatureDynamics"] = 128] = "SignatureDynamics";
BioFactor[BioFactor["KeystrokeDynamics"] = 256] = "KeystrokeDynamics";
BioFactor[BioFactor["LipMovement"] = 512] = "LipMovement";
BioFactor[BioFactor["ThermalFaceImage"] = 1024] = "ThermalFaceImage";
BioFactor[BioFactor["ThermalHandImage"] = 2048] = "ThermalHandImage";
BioFactor[BioFactor["Gait"] = 4096] = "Gait";
})(BioFactor || (BioFactor = {}));
/**
* Biometric owner ID registered with {@link http://www.ibia.org/base/cbeff/_biometric_org.phpx | IBIA}.
*/
export var BioSampleFormatOwner;
(function (BioSampleFormatOwner) {
BioSampleFormatOwner[BioSampleFormatOwner["None"] = 0] = "None";
/** Neurotechnologija (fingerprints). */
BioSampleFormatOwner[BioSampleFormatOwner["Neurotechnologija"] = 49] = "Neurotechnologija";
/** DigitalPersona (fingerprints) */
BioSampleFormatOwner[BioSampleFormatOwner["DigitalPersona"] = 51] = "DigitalPersona";
/** Cognitec (face) */
BioSampleFormatOwner[BioSampleFormatOwner["Cognitec"] = 99] = "Cognitec";
/** Innovatrics (face) */
BioSampleFormatOwner[BioSampleFormatOwner["Innovatrics"] = 53] = "Innovatrics";
})(BioSampleFormatOwner || (BioSampleFormatOwner = {}));
/**
* Biometric sample format info.
*/
var BioSampleFormat = /** @class */ (function () {
function BioSampleFormat(FormatOwner, FormatID) {
this.FormatOwner = FormatOwner;
this.FormatID = FormatID;
}
return BioSampleFormat;
}());
export { BioSampleFormat };
/**
* A representation type of a biometric sample.
*/
export var BioSampleType;
(function (BioSampleType) {
BioSampleType[BioSampleType["Raw"] = 1] = "Raw";
BioSampleType[BioSampleType["Intermediate"] = 2] = "Intermediate";
BioSampleType[BioSampleType["Processed"] = 4] = "Processed";
BioSampleType[BioSampleType["RawWSQCompressed"] = 8] = "RawWSQCompressed";
BioSampleType[BioSampleType["Encrypted"] = 16] = "Encrypted";
BioSampleType[BioSampleType["Signed"] = 32] = "Signed";
})(BioSampleType || (BioSampleType = {}));
/**
* A purpose the biometric sample was intended for.
*/
export var BioSamplePurpose;
(function (BioSamplePurpose) {
BioSamplePurpose[BioSamplePurpose["Any"] = 0] = "Any";
BioSamplePurpose[BioSamplePurpose["Verify"] = 1] = "Verify";
BioSamplePurpose[BioSamplePurpose["Identify"] = 2] = "Identify";
BioSamplePurpose[BioSamplePurpose["Enroll"] = 3] = "Enroll";
BioSamplePurpose[BioSamplePurpose["EnrollForVerificationOnly"] = 4] = "EnrollForVerificationOnly";
BioSamplePurpose[BioSamplePurpose["EnrollForIdentificationOnly"] = 5] = "EnrollForIdentificationOnly";
BioSamplePurpose[BioSamplePurpose["Audit"] = 6] = "Audit";
})(BioSamplePurpose || (BioSamplePurpose = {}));
/**
* A biometric sample encryption type.
*/
export var BioSampleEncryption;
(function (BioSampleEncryption) {
BioSampleEncryption[BioSampleEncryption["None"] = 0] = "None";
BioSampleEncryption[BioSampleEncryption["XTEA"] = 1] = "XTEA";
})(BioSampleEncryption || (BioSampleEncryption = {}));
/**
* Contains meta-information about biometric sample data.
*/
var BioSampleHeader = /** @class */ (function () {
function BioSampleHeader(
/** Biometric factor. Must be set to 8 for fingerprint. */
Factor,
/** Format owner (vendor) information. */
Format,
/** Biometric sample representation type. */
Type,
/** Purpose of the biometric sample. */
Purpose,
/** Quality of biometric sample. If we don't support quality it should be set to -1. */
Quality,
/** Encryption of biometric sample. */
Encryption) {
this.Factor = Factor;
this.Format = Format;
this.Type = Type;
this.Purpose = Purpose;
this.Quality = Quality;
this.Encryption = Encryption;
}
return BioSampleHeader;
}());
export { BioSampleHeader };
/**
* A biometric sample.
*/
var BioSample = /** @class */ (function () {
function BioSample(
/** Biometric sample header. */
Header,
/** Base64url encoded biometric sample data */
Data) {
this.Header = Header;
this.Data = Data;
/** A version info. */
this.Version = 1;
}
return BioSample;
}());
export { BioSample };
